I had a similar fight recently..

Initially my doc was happy to prescribe strips... then i went on to insulin and had to see another doc who told me to stop testing... is he on drugs??


went back to my original doc who said that there had been a practise meeting the previous week and any T2 not on insulin were not allowed any more strips...

I got mine back on prescription and he apologised and suggested maybe the other doc hadnt realised I was now on insulin...
 
I'm also a member of the wot no strips club...

My PCT have decided that type twos who arn't taking insulin are not allowed to be prescribed test strips...except i think i'm allowewd one box a year so that i can test, if i'm ill. Some of our nurses disagree with this, but the powers that be have spoken. my surgery is of the opinion that over testing makes you paranoid, the leading hospital consultant thinks i'm bright enough to judge for myself. It's not even as if my surgery demand an hba1c every three months, once a year would seem the norm...Still due for another in September, and if it's over 7 i shall kick up a fuss...oh and demand more drugs.
